Live Video Surveillance with a Twist
Ravi installed digital signage and small SmartTV screens at key points such as expensive electronics. The screens displayed real-time video of customers as they shopped and it was accompanied with a message that they are on camera and shoplifters will be prosecuted. It had immediate impact and potential thieves used to think twice before acting.
